February Weather in Santiago de Puringla, Honduras

Last updated: August 23, 2025

In February, the average temperature in Santiago de Puringla, Honduras hovers around 20°C (68°F), offering a pleasant climate for outdoor activities. Expect minimum temperatures to dip to 10°C (51°F), while peaks can reach a warm 32°C (89°F). The region experiences light rainfall, with an average precipitation of 8 mm (0.3 in) spread over 2 days. With an average humidity of 72%, the air can feel comfortably fresh during this time.

February UV Index in Santiago de Puringla

In Santiago de Puringla in February, the maximum UV index reaches 13, which corresponds to an extreme Exposure Category. With a time to burn of just 10 minutes, it's crucial to take protective measures. For detailed information, you can check the Hourly UV Index in Santiago de Puringla.

UV Risk Categories

  •  Extreme (11+): Avoid the sun, stay in shade.
  •  Very High (8-10): Limit sun exposure.
  •  High (6-7): Use SPF 30+ and protective clothing.
  •  Moderate (3-5): Midday shade recommended.
  •  Low (0-2): No protection needed.
